Understanding the Tenant Rental Application

The Tenant Rental Application is a crucial document used during the process of renting a property. This application serves both potential renters seeking housing and landlords requiring a thorough evaluation of applicants. It encapsulates essential information that facilitates the decision-making process for landlords while providing transparency to applicants.
The application typically requests personal, employment, and residence details, ensuring landlords have the necessary background to assess applicants properly. Filling out the rental application form accurately is vital to prevent delays in the rental process.

Key Information Required in the Tenant Rental Application

When filling out the Tenant Rental Application, applicants must provide critical information that includes:
  • Personal details: Full Legal Name, Date of Birth, and Social Security Number
  • Employment history: Current employer name, position, and income verification
  • Residency history: Previous addresses and landlord references
Additionally, applicants must attach specific documents, such as a driver's license, social security card, and pay stubs for income verification. Accurate completion of all fields is essential, including signatures and authorization for landlord verification to avoid potential issues.

Common Errors in Filling Out the Tenant Rental Application and How to Avoid Them

Applicants should be mindful of common errors that may lead to delays or rejections. Frequent mistakes include:
  • Omitting critical information
  • Providing incorrect or outdated documentation
To avoid these issues, double-check the application before submitting it. Utilizing available resources or consulting with someone experienced can also provide clarity and assistance during completion.
